Output efedfb67ab3d7cf6e7c42573b2224ea483762a16e2ce99a58df100b9b807aa62:0

value
4410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89630308af51533c8f18efce6c33da6864e16e5f OP_EQUAL
address
3EDT7HgwjzfFwGzcNJ7i43nma3bXd7TPXg
transaction
efedfb67ab3d7cf6e7c42573b2224ea483762a16e2ce99a58df100b9b807aa62
spent
true